The financial institution has brought in a professional with a decade of experience in the sector, focused on designing investment strategies and comprehensive portfolio management. This addition aligns with Singular Bank's strategy to expand its network of financial agents in the Andalusian region.
The new agent, holding a degree in Business Administration and Management from the University of Seville, possesses certifications such as EFPA and the EFP Planner title. His career includes previous experience in financial advisory and in the expansion area of a renowned retail sector company.
This reinforcement coincides with a significant boost in Singular Bank's business in Andalusia. In 2025, the entity increased its managed assets in the community by 35.6%, exceeding 715 million euros. The bank currently operates from its offices in Seville and Malaga, and plans to open a new branch in Granada, with the goal of reaching 1 billion euros under management in the region within the next two years.
Nationally, Singular Bank closed 2025 with record growth, surpassing 17 billion euros in managed assets for the first time, reaching 17.396 billion euros, representing an annual increase of 18%. The entity's operating profit tripled in that fiscal year, reaching 12.3 million euros.
The positive trend has continued into early 2026, with operating profit tripling again in the first quarter to 2.97 million euros, and client assets under management increasing by 15% to 17.758 billion euros.
